Surfaces should be coated with fire-retardant paint to slow flame spread and increase heat resistance. Install fire barriers within the tray to isolate different fire zones. When cable trays pass through walls or floors, seal openings using fire-rated penetration sealing materials. The fire rating of slot-type fire-resistant Cable Trays is primarily determined by their fire endurance (the time during which the structure and electrical circuit remain intact under standard flame conditions). Type MC or TC cable was permitted in ladder, ventilated trough, or ventilated channel in a single layer with a space not less than the largest cable diameter between them.
